All 20 terms

TermDefinition
Agricultureactivities concerned with the production of plants and animals, and the related supplies, services, mechanics, produces, processing, and marketing
Agriculture educationteaching and program management in agriculture
Soil sciencestudy of the properties and management of soil to grow plants
Biologybasic science of the plant and the animal kingdoms
Animal scienceanimal growth, care, and management
Technologyapplication of science to an industrial or commercial objective
Organic foodfood that has been grown without the use of certain chemical pesticides
Renewable natural resourcesresources provided by nature that can replace themselves
Agribusinesscommercial firms that have developed with or stem out of agriculture
Environmentspace and mass around us
Agricultural engineeringapplication of engineers principles in agricultural settings
Ornamentalsscience of fruits, vegetables, adn ornamental plants
Chemistryscience dealing with the characteristics of elements of simple substances
Agriscienceall jobs related in some way to plants, animals, and renewable natural resources
Crop scienceuse of modern principals in growing and managing crops
Biochemistrychemistry as it applies to living matter
Entomologyscience of insect life
Agronomyscience of soils and field crops
Horticulturethe science of producing, processing, and marketing fruits, vegetables, and ornamental plants
Aquacultureraising of finfish, shellfish, and other aquatic animals under controlled conditions
